WebNov 2, 2024 · Keeping the toe from moving. To heal, a broken bone must not move so that its ends can knit back together. Examples include: Buddy taping. For a simple fracture in any of the smaller toes, taping the injured toe to one next to it might be all that's needed. The uninjured toe acts like a splint. Otherwise, you can treat your... WebMar 22, 2024 · Podiatry 24 years experience Many reasons possibl: A bruised swollen toe can occur due to an injury such as a contusion or a fracture. Infection can also cause swelling and a bruised feeling, commonly an ingrown toenail can cause these symptoms. Another possible reason is an acute gout attack.

WebJun 11, 2024 · Gout is a type of arthritis that typically attacks the big toe, but it can affect knees and sometimes other joints. WebNov 4, 2024 · Elevate the bruised area above heart level, if possible. Apply an ice pack wrapped in a thin towel. Leave it in place for 20 minutes. Repeat several times for a day or two after the injury. This helps to reduce the swelling and pain. If the bruised area is swelling, put an elastic bandage around it, but not too tight.
WebNov 3, 2024 · Purple Toe Syndrome (also known as “trash foot”), appears as a blue or purple discoloration of one or more toes without any prior physical injury or cold trauma (such as hypothermia). 1 This painful condition can develop quite suddenly.
